Focus and Scope

EDUCA: Jurnal Pendidikan Indonesia is dedicated to publishing high-quality, peer-reviewed articles that contribute to the advancement of knowledge and practice in the field of education. Our goal is to provide a platform for researchers, academicians, professionals, and practitioners to share important new knowledge and outstanding developments that are highly relevant to the educational community.

The journal welcomes original research articles, theoretical papers, empirical studies, and systematic literature reviews. The scope of EDUCA covers a wide range of educational aspects, including but not limited to the following areas:

 Education & Teaching

Exploration of fundamental educational theories, pedagogical practices, teacher education, and the overall dynamics of the teaching-learning process.

  Instruction & Development

Curriculum development, instructional design, material development, and strategies for improving educational standards and outcomes.

  Projects & Innovations

Implementation of innovative educational projects, creative teaching models, and new paradigms in solving educational challenges.

  Learning Methodologies

Research on diverse teaching methodologies, active learning, collaborative learning, and techniques to enhance student engagement.

  New Technologies

Integration of ICT in education, e-learning platforms, digital learning tools, artificial intelligence in education, and multimedia learning.

  Assessment

Formative and summative assessments, evaluation metrics, testing methods, and the analysis of student performance and educational programs.

  Counseling

School counseling, educational guidance, psychological support for students, and mental health well-being in educational environments.

  Special Need Education

Inclusive education practices, strategies for teaching students with disabilities, and the development of tailored learning environments.

  Long-life Learning

Adult education, continuous professional development, non-formal education, and community-based learning initiatives.
